University Hospitals of North Midlands NHS Trust in Stafford is looking for Pharmacy Technicians to join our bank team across two sites, Royal Stoke and County Hospital. This flexible, zero-hour bank contract offers experience across wards and dispensary work.
You will handle dispensing controlled drugs, gain experience with IT systems like Ascribe and Omnicell, maintain stock, support medicines optimisation, and help train junior staff. We value accuracy, teamwork and adaptability.
At present, University Hospitals of North Midlands is unable to offer visa sponsorship for Band 2 to Band 4 roles, as these positions do not meet the minimum salary and skill thresholds required under UK Visas and Immigration (UKVI) regulations.

University Hospitals of North Midlands NHS Trust is one of the largest and most modern in the country. Based across two sites, Royal Stoke in Stoke-on-Trent and County Hospital in Stafford, we are proud to serve around three million people and we're highly regarded for our facilities, teaching and research. We are the specialist centre for major trauma for the North Midlands and North Wales.
